Hi, I am really enjoying downloading some of these new planes however I do not have a lot of available extra space. My question is how do I , or can I, get rid of some of the planes that came with my AFPD, which would make room for some of the others I would like to download? Any one have a step by step type of answer? Thank you
Steve
Old 05-29-2009, 09:10 PM
  #65  
rajul
Moderator
Thread Starter
My Feedback: (58)
 
rajul's Avatar
 
Join Date: Jun 2002
Location: Missouri City, TX
Posts: 8,248
Likes: 0
Received 2 Likes on 2 Posts
Default RE: Free AFP and AFPD models and sceneries!

Steve, what you need to do is go into the "aircraft" folder in the AFPD directory and delete whichever model folder that you don't need. I sugest that you back up these model folders in a thumb drive or floppy disk just in case you need them again in the future.
